How to get out of tooth pain fast
Have you, a friend, family member or co-worker ever had a toothache in the middle of the night? How about swelling around a tooth, a swollen cheek, or a draining blister on your gums? Have you ever wondered who to call or where to go? If a person doesn’t have a regular dentist it can be a confusing experience. Some people may choose to go to the emergency room. This is not the best choice because there is often no one there to treat the likely source of the problem. At best you may leave with a prescription for pain medication … Continue reading

What everyone should know about how teeth chip or break
As with everything you want to keep for a long time, teeth need to be taken care of. You need to brush and floss your teeth everyday at home and you need to see a dentist on a regular basis. I see patients all the time that have a cracked tooth, or part of their tooth has broken off. Many times I hear “Doc, I was taking a bite of bread and my tooth broke” or “I bit into a pretzel and that’s what broke my tooth”. Well, your teeth are strong.
